Polo mints were first introduced in the United Kingdom in 1948 by Rowntree's. The brand is famous for its 'mint with the hole' marketing campaign and its distinctive ring shape. The name is often associated with the sport of polo, suggesting a sense of coolness and class.
Today, the brand is owned by the Swiss multinational food and drink conglomerate Nestlé, which acquired Rowntree's in 1988. The majority of Polo mints sold in the UK and Ireland are produced at the Nestlé factory in York. Nestlé oversees the brand's global distribution, maintaining its status as one of the most recognizable breath mint brands in the world.
